Description
- 2-picolylamine is a bihaptic amine that can be used:
- As a key precursor to synthesize various ionic liquids through the formation of α-amino alcohols as intermediates
- As a chelating ligand for the synthesis of complexes such as zinc picolylamine complex and cu(ii) picolylamine complex
- To functionalize poly(styrene-co-maleic anhydride) (psma) resin to facilitate the adsorption of uranium from aqueous solution
Specifications
Specifications
| CAS | 3731-51-9 |
| Density | 1.049 g/mL at 25°C (lit.) |
| Boiling Point | 82°C to 85°°C (12 mmHg) |
| Molecular Formula | C6H8N2 |
| Refractive Index | n20/D 1.544 (lit.) |
| Linear Formula | C6H8N2 |
| MDL Number | MFCD00006360 |
| Quantity | 5 g |
| Synonym | 2-(Aminomethyl)pyridine |
| Molecular Weight (g/mol) | 108.14 |
